DaveJL Posted September 12, 2012 Author Share Posted September 12, 2012 (edited) The build really has come together today. First thing i did was to add the decals. The 'stars 'n bars' and stencils are from the kit with the rest from the Kitsworld sheet. Once they had set, i gave a quick spray of flat varnish. Inadvertently, this got mixed with some standing water on the paint work and initially I thought i had a disaster on my hands. However, the two seemed to have mixed to give a very nice and effective weathering look in certain areas! Also attached all the glazing and .50cals, except for the twin tail guns. Note here that the waist gunners windows are not a good fit. For the weathering, i used tamiya pigment but i was struggling to replicate the really greasy looking stains found around the engines and superchargers. So i dampened the areas that needed seeing to then rubbed the pigment in before removing the excess with a finger. The result is streaky looking oil stains, particularly around the cowlings. Next up is to add the props, tail guns and tidy up a few bits and pieces. More to come. Dave Edited September 12, 2012 by DaveJL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

If you can find any pics of Hikin for home with the red tips and stabilizers, please let me know and I'll correct! Dave I stand corrected! I found a couple of pictures and you're spot on - only red on the vertical fin. I wonder if she was in an interim scheme when the pictures, and hence your decal guide, were taken? Nearly every other 91stBG B-17 in pictures have the red wing tips and stabilisers - it seems 'Hikin for Home' was an exception to the rule. You learn something every day!
